At Dr Sknn we take advantage of the Lynton Lumina, a sophisticated Intense Pulsed Light System (IPL), which is also utilised by NHS and private hospitals around the UK, with the purpose of treating Thread Vein with accuracy, safety and efficacy on skin types I-IV. By emitting light in a specific wavelength ranges, at Dr Sknn we target absorption peaks in haemoglobin and oxy-haemoglobin, allowing us to treat Thread Vein at various sizes and at various depths while causing minimal damage to the neighbouring skin. Following the treatment the damaged vessels are absorbed by the body and little or no sign of the initial lesion is visible.

At Dr Sknn, we utilise Intense Pulsed Light (IPL) to deliver light energy. This energy is taken in by the blood vessels, heating them up until they contract or cease to function, and then sealing them. In the weeks to come, the broken vessels are naturally reabsorbed by the body, leaving no trace of the blemish.

At Dr Sknn, a full medical history and physical assessment, along with photographs, will be done to make sure a successful consultation. During the consultation there will be a chance to voice any apprehensions, expectations, results, or queries. Ahead of treatment, all post-treatment advice and potential dangers related to the Intense Pulsed Light (IPL) procedure are discussed in depth to make sure you are cognizant of them, and a consent form must be signed. Additionally, a small patch test may be carried out if it is a novel area being treated to guarantee its suitability.
